van der Ark, L. Andries; Croon, Marcel A.; Sijtsma, Klaas – Psychometrika, 2008
Scalability coefficients play an important role in Mokken scale analysis. For a set of items, scalability coefficients have been defined for each pair of items, for each individual item, and for the entire scale. Hypothesis testing with respect to these scalability coefficients has not been fully developed. This study introduces marginal modelling…

Feldt, Leonard S. – Psychometrika, 1980
Procedures are developed for testing the hypothesis that Cronbach's alpha reliability coefficient is equal for two tests given to the same subjects. (Author/JKS)

Raaijmakers, Jeroen G. W.; Pieters, Jo P. M. – Psychometrika, 1987
Functional and structural relationship alternatives to the standard "F"-test for analysis of covariance (ANCOVA) are discussed for cases when the covariate is measured with error. An approximate statistical test based on the functional relationship approach is preferred on the basis of Monte Carlo simulation results. (SLD)
